Installation Process: Desktop vs Mobile

Installing 1xbet on desktop and mobile devices involves distinct steps and requirements. Desktop users need to visit the official 1xbet website, download the appropriate version for their operating system, and complete an installation wizard. The process usually takes a few minutes and requires some level of computer knowledge, such as adjusting security settings to allow the software.

On the other hand, mobile installation is often more straightforward but varies by platform:

  1. Android: Due to Google Play restrictions, users must download the APK file directly from the 1xbet site and enable “Install from unknown sources” in settings.
  2. iOS: The app is typically available through the App Store, making the download and installation as easy as any other app.

While desktop app installation is more involved, mobile installation prioritizes ease and speed, reflecting the preferences of mobile users. Both require regular updates to keep the app functioning optimally.
